摘要
The high temperature reaction of C-60 with silver(I) trifluoroacetate followed by 500 degreesC sublimation and subsequent HPLC purification has led to the isolation of the five trifluoromethyl[60]fullerenes C-60(CF3)(n) (n = 2, 4, 6, 8, 10). Four of them have >90% compositional purity. Two of the compounds. C-60(CF3)(4) and C-60(CF3)(6), were obtained as C-1-symmetry isomers with >90% isomeric purity, and a sample of C-60(CF3)(2) also contained ca. 15-20% of a C-s-symmetry isomer of C-60(CF3)(4). The new compounds were characterized by IR and EI mass spectrometry (all five compounds), F-19 NMR spectroscopy (C-60(CF3)(2), C-60(CF3)(4), and C-60(CF3)(6)), and 2D COSY F-19 NMR spectroscopy (C-60(CF3)(4) and C-60(CF3)(6)). Calculations at the AM1 and DFT levels of theory have led to the prediction of the most likely structures for C-60(CF3)(2), C-1-C-60(CF3)(4), Cs-C-60(CF3)(4), and the two most likely structures of C-1-C-60(CF3)(6).
